Multimedia outfit The Voder undertook a seven-month exploration at an undisclosed abandoned madhouse and snapped 35,000 still images to create Asylum.
From the Vimeo page:
Our 7 month journey into the Asylum led us on many adventures; from dodging security vehicles, ghostly figures and even a meth head. This is no place for the faint of heart. Asbestos blanketed every room we entered like new winter snow, so shooting was sometimes difficult.
The production consisted of a 5D Mark II and some HDR/tone-mapping techniques. Great job, guys. Hopefully the ghosts of the asylum were pleased with the result. If not, they could, you know, haunt your dreams forever. [Vimeo via FStoppers]
